Fecal egg count (FEC) test kits measure parasite egg burdens in animal manure and are a key tool for parasite control in UK farming and equine sectors. These kits appeal to livestock keepers, horse owners and smallholder farmers because they enable evidence based treatment decisions, reduce routine blanket dosing and help manage drug resistance. UK consumers increasingly value easy to use kits, rapid turnaround times, and clear interpretation support from laboratories or vets. Trends toward sustainable farming, targeted parasite control and on farm diagnostics have made FEC kits an attractive investment for anyone managing sheep, cattle, horses or goats who wants to protect animal health while reducing costs and chemical use.

What the research says about fecal egg counts

Scientific studies and veterinary guidance show that regular fecal egg counting is an effective component of integrated parasite control. FEC testing identifies whether animals actually need treatment, supports selective dosing of high shedders, and is a practical way to slow the development of anthelmintic resistance. Multiple validated methods, from McMaster and Mini-FLOTAC flotation techniques to laboratory PCR assays, are used depending on required sensitivity and budget. Research also highlights limitations: single counts can vary with sample timing and technique, and interpretation is most reliable when combined with herd or flock history and professional veterinary advice.

→

Selective treatment guided by FEC can substantially reduce the total amount of anthelmintic used while maintaining animal performance and welfare.

→

Validated flotation methods like McMaster and Mini-FLOTAC provide practical on farm egg counts; laboratory PCR offers higher sensitivity for species identification when needed.

→

Regular monitoring, typically timed around turnout and post-treatment checks, helps detect rising burdens early and supports targeted control plans.

→

FEC results should be interpreted with veterinary input because egg counts are influenced by season, age, species, and sampling technique.
